Commercial impedance analyzers or bridges are specially designed to measure the impedance of discrete electronic components. When they are intended to measure the impedance of materials, which normally have high contact impedances, the accuracy of the measurement is degraded and in some situations it becomes impossible. The object of this patent is a method and an electronic circuit that connects between the standard terminals of a commercial impedance bridge and the material to be measured. The measurement method used is the one known as 4-wire or terminals, since this method minimizes the effect of contact impedances, and in turn the common mode voltage feedback technique and that of current convectors. The method and device presented improves the accuracy of the impedance measurement of materials that have high contact impedances.
